    David Hasselhoff's ex-wife Pamela Bach-Hasselhoff has reportedly died by suicide at the age of 62.

    Bach-Hasselhoff, who worked as an actress, was found dead at her $2million Hollywood Hills home of a self-inflicted gunshot wound Wednesday night.

    Authorities said there was no suicide note left at her home, which is a
    stone's throw from Universal Studios.

    An autopsy will be conducted later on Thursday, according to the medical examiner's office.

    Bach-Hasselhoff was married to the Baywatch star, 72, between 1989 and
    2006, when he filed for divorce, citing irreconcilable differences.

    The pair had a contentious divorce; she accused him of domestic abuse and
    they had public arguments about spousal support continuing until 2017.

    They shared two daughters, 32-year-old Hayley and 34-year-old Taylor. Bach-Hasselhoff is also survived by a granddaughter named London.

    Bach-Hasselhoff's debut movie role was Francis Ford Coppola's Rumble Fish
    in 1983.

    She met Hasselhoff on the set of Knight Rider.

    In 1989, she also snared a role in Baywatch, playing café owner Kaye
    Morgan.

    Some of her other TV roles included jobs on The Young and the Restless, The Fall Guy and Sirens.

    She did not return to acting in recent years; In 2011, she appeared on Celebrity Big Brother.

    After their 2006 divorce, Hasselhoff complained several times about the
    alimony he continue to pay to his ex-wife until at least 2017.

    In 2017, it was reported the couple agreed that Hasselhoff would pay her
    $5,000 every month.

    Hasselhoff had the alimony reduced from as much as $21,000 a month after he argued his income has been reduced.

    The actor said at that point he had paid Bach-Hasselhoff over $2.5 mil
    since their divorce in 2006.

    A video of Hasselhoff drunkenly eating a burger led to him temporarily
    losing visitation privileges with his daughters, but they were restored
    after two weeks. The actor acknowledged the video, shot by one of his daughters, showed him during an alcohol relapse but he denied abuse
    allegations at the time.

    In 2018, David Hasselhoff married model Hayley Roberts.
